What's in the feed now

Tax year 2024 — spent $181,280 more than it took in. Revenue $3,545,495 · expenses $3,726,775 · reserve months -0.4
Tax year 2023 — spent $580,013 more than it took in. Revenue $2,249,041 · expenses $2,829,054 · reserve months 0.2
Tax year 2022 — took in $440,025 more than it spent. Revenue $3,025,253 · expenses $2,585,228 · reserve months 2.9
Tax year 2021 — spent $206,394 more than it took in. Revenue $1,149,832 · expenses $1,356,226 · reserve months 1.6
Tax year 2020 — spent $320,326 more than it took in. Revenue $740,354 · expenses $1,060,680 · reserve months 4.4
Tax year 2019 — took in $78,652 more than it spent. Revenue $821,136 · expenses $742,484 · reserve months 11.5
Tax year 2018 — took in $586,626 more than it spent. Revenue $959,415 · expenses $372,789 · reserve months 20.2
Tax year 2017 — spent $120,018 more than it took in. Revenue $94,086 · expenses $214,104 · reserve months 2.4
Tax year 2016 — spent $200,852 more than it took in. Revenue $15,058 · expenses $215,910 · reserve months 9.0
Tax year 2015 — spent $214,272 more than it took in. Revenue $19,211 · expenses $233,483 · reserve months 20.3
Tax year 2014 — took in $113,799 more than it spent. Revenue $300,047 · expenses $186,248 · reserve months 39.3
Tax year 2013 — took in $495,938 more than it spent. Revenue $500,200 · expenses $4,262 · reserve months 1396.4
